Kenneth R Booth 1935 - 2011

Kenneth R Booth was born on June 10, 1935, and died at age 76 years old on October 30, 2011. Kenneth Booth was buried at Chattanooga National Cemetery Section JJ Site 526 1200 Bailey Avenue, in Chattanooga, Tn.
